DARS

The Degree Audit Reporting System (DARS) is an advising tool that is designed to help students identify requirements necessary to complete their degree or program of study.     

Yours DARS report will show you:

  • Courses or requirements already completed and/or still need to complete.
  • Course options to help plan a semester schedule.
  • Transfer courses received from other colleges/universities and their application toward a degree or program requirement.
  • Approved Academic Petitions/Exceptions to requirements or credit by exam.

What the DARS is Not
The DARS report is not a transcript.  DARS is a tool designed to assist you and your advisor/counselor in the advising process.   It is not intended to report student achievement to outside parties.  Federal law prohibits transmission to a third party. 

How do I get my DARS audit?

  • Login to your online student account
  • Enter your Student ID number and PIN.
  • Click on Grades and Transcripts
  • Select Degree Audit Report
